  • Registered Users Posts: 905 ✭✭✭styron


    It's not you, mainland only restriction apply on certain items including perfume:
    The following items may only be delivered to addresses within mainland UK, Germany, France, Italy, Spain and Portugal, some addresses in Denmark, or Austria, Belgium, Luxembourg, Netherlands, Poland, Czech Republic, Hungary, Monaco, or Vatican City (Holy See):
    Aerosols.
    Many beauty items including hair dyes, perfumes, nail polish and mascara.
    Certain batteries.
    Combustible, explosive, flammable, or corrosive materials.
    Cleaners or fuel.
    Certain sunscreens.
    Some alcohol-based products including marker pens (excluding alcoholic beverages).
    Certain insecticides.
    Certain adhesives.
    Air fresheners.

    https://www.amazon.co.uk/gp/help/customer/display.html?nodeId=201337930

  • Closed Accounts Posts: 18,268 ✭✭✭✭uck51js9zml2yt


    Just received a Parcel which was sent to me Motel to Motel, the guy put it into his local Motel in WestMeath on Monday Evening and it took until this morning (Friday Morning) to reach me in Killarney. 4 days? I only had a Motel to Motel delivery once before and it took over a week but I blamed that on the Christmas rush at the time.

    What is other peoples experiences of Motel to Motel internal deliverys by Parcel Motel like? It wasn't time sensitive and I was expecting it to be slow, but I'm wondering is this the norm or exception, based on others experiences?

    I wouldn't call that bad.
    Pick up in WM Monday evening or more likely Tuesday( depending on time it was put in the box and van arriving). Back to Dublin Tuesday evening.Sorting Tuesday night/Wednesday. Out for delivery with other calls en route Thursday. Drop to Killarney Thursday night and you pick up Friday morning.
